How they compare
Grenada currently reports 30.2% against 30.2% in Bahamas,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 26 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Bahamas ahead.
Bahamas ranks 124th and Grenada ranks 123rd of 177 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Bahamas averaged higher in 1 and Grenada in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bahamas | Grenada |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 7.7% | 0.1% | 7.6% | Bahamas |
| 2010s | 19.7% | 24.2% | 4.5% | Grenada |
| 2020s | 30.2% | 30.2% | 0.0% | Grenada |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
